Best AI Text-to-Speech Tools in 2026: Most Natural Voices
TL;DR: ElevenLabs for the most natural English voices. Murf AI for enterprise with the widest language support. NaturalReader for simple document reading. PlayHT for developers.
AI text-to-speech has reached the point where generated voices are virtually indistinguishable from humans. Whether you need voiceovers for videos, audiobooks, or accessibility features, these tools deliver studio-quality results.
Top Picks at a Glance
1. ElevenLabs
Gold standard for voice naturalness. Captures breathing, emotional depth, and pacing variations that make voices virtually indistinguishable from humans.
| Best For | Content creators needing the most realistic voices |
| Pricing | Free tier — Pro from $5/mo |
| Key Feature | Most natural-sounding AI voices available |
2. Murf AI
Enterprise-focused TTS with 120+ voices in 20+ languages. 44.1kHz sampling rate captures full human audible range. Easy studio interface.
| Best For | Enterprise e-learning and corporate videos |
| Pricing | From $23/mo |
| Key Feature | 120+ studio-quality voices with collaboration tools |
3. PlayHT
Ultra-realistic voices with extensive customization. Offers voice cloning and a large voice library. Strong API for developers.
| Best For | Developers and API-first workflows |
| Pricing | Free tier — Pro from $29/mo |
| Key Feature | Extensive voice library with developer API |
4. NaturalReader
Simple text-to-speech with 56 natural voices in 9 languages. Great for reading documents, PDFs, and web pages aloud.
| Best For | Students and professionals who need documents read aloud |
| Pricing | Free tier — Premium from $10/mo |
| Key Feature | PDF and document reader with natural voices |
5. LOVO AI
AI voiceover platform with 500+ voices. Includes video editing tools alongside TTS for complete content production.
| Best For | Marketing teams creating video content |
| Pricing | From $24/mo |
| Key Feature | Combined TTS and video editing platform |

FAQ
Can AI voices replace human voiceover artists?
For most commercial applications, yes. Top AI voices are now indistinguishable from humans in short clips. Long-form content like audiobooks may still benefit from human narrators for emotional nuance.
Are AI-generated voices free to use commercially?
Paid plans include commercial usage rights. Free tiers typically have restrictions. Always check the license terms for your specific use case.
Which TTS tool has the lowest latency?
Fish Audio offers sub-500ms time-to-first-audio, making it best for real-time conversational applications. ElevenLabs also offers streaming with low latency.
